The Role of REACH Compliance in Testing Color Fastness in Textiles: A Crucial Laboratory Service for Businesses

In todays highly competitive and regulated textile industry, ensuring the compliance of your products with European Unions Registration, Evaluation, Authorisation, and Restriction of Chemicals (REACH) regulations is no longer a choice but a necessity. REACH, which came into effect in 2007, aims to improve the protection of human health and the environment by regulating the safe use of chemical substances. One critical aspect of REACH compliance is testing color fastness in textiles, which involves assessing the ability of colors to resist fading or bleeding when exposed to various environmental conditions.

    What is REACH Compliance?

    REACH (Registration, Evaluation, Authorisation, and Restriction of Chemicals) is a European Union regulation that aims to improve the protection of human health and the environment by regulating the safe use of chemical substances. It requires manufacturers and importers to register their chemicals with the EUs Chemicals Agency (ECHA).
